San Juan del Sur is approximately 1 1/2 hours from Casa Castillo, but well worth the drive.

San Juan del Sur has a rich history, starting from the 1600’s when the Spanish conquistadors used it as a safe anchorage to today as a Californian surf vibe. The area is spotted with many hidden beaches along the coast (some which were used in television show, Survivor seasons 2010, 2011 and 2015.)

There is much to do, from fishing, horseback riding, off road motorcycle trail riding, surfing, and if you’re lucky you may see an International surfing competition. Night life is very popular for the young people or young at heart.

A statue of Christ of the Mercy adorns the northern hillside of the bay that is familiar to the Brazilian beach in Rio.
